While the Lancia Delta HF Integrale was out devouring special stage after special stage in the 1990s, winning every rally trophy there was to win and making the headlines virtually every weekend, the marque’s bigwigs were being ferried between boardrooms up and down Italy in one of these: the Kappa SW Turbo. Fewer than 10,000 of these distinguished Pininfarina-designed estates were built, but while the Turbo version was powered by the same 2.0-litre Lampredi four-pot engine as that found in the Integrale, the Kappa flew under the radar of enthusiasts, and continues to do so today.



The Swiss market for collector cars is one of the most interesting in the world. After all, between Basel, Bern, Geneva, Lugano and Zurich, you’ll find not only precious blue-chip cars, but also rare and obscure cars at low prices, and mostly in great condition. The next auction from Oldtimer Galerie Toffen on 17 October offers an insight into this exciting market.



Gooding & Company is pleased to announce an exciting new platform for auctions to be held exclusively through the company’s website and mobile bidding app. The online auction series will complement the company’s annual live auction events and offer a selection of reserve and no reserve lots, providing a superb array of automotive brilliance for every level of collector. Gooding & Company plans to house all vehicles included in the online auction within one accessible setting, providing the unique ability to offer on-site inspections for interested bidders and to personally engage with each available lot on behalf of buyers and sellers.
